Commit Message

Tom Tromey Sept. 18, 2023, 2:52 p.m. UTC
  This converts the target fileio BFD iovec implementation to use the
new type-safe gdb_bfd_openr_iovec.
---
 gdb/gdb_bfd.c | 97 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-----------------------------
 1 file changed, 50 insertions(+), 47 deletions(-)
